#501ba4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#501ba4 is composed of 31.4% red, 10.6% green and 64.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 51.2% cyan, 83.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 35.7% black. It has a hue angle of 263.2 degrees, a saturation of 71.7% and a lightness of 37.5%. #501ba4 color hex could be obtained by blending #a036ff with #000049.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

#501ba4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#501ba4 has RGB values of R:80, G:27, B:164 and CMYK values of C:0.51, M:0.84, Y:0, K:0.36. Its decimal value is 5249956.
